We are thrilled to welcome the world to Seattle as a host city for this global event
One of the most anticipated events in sports, FIFA World Cup 26™ will be hosted across North America with games in the US, Mexico, and Canada.
Seattle is excited to host six matches from June 15-July 6.
Visitors traveling through Seattle by car during select weekends may encounter increased traffic during Interstate 5 upgrades. More information is available on our Travel Advisory page.
